С лучшими из нас случаются забывание или потеря паролей, и если вы обнаружили, что ваша установка Strapi заблокирована, не волнуйтесь! В этой статье блога мы рассмотрим различные методы и приемы, которые помогут вам восстановить пароль Strapi и восстановить доступ к вашей системе управления контентом. Итак, давайте углубимся и вернем вас в нужное русло!
Метод 1: использование функции «Забыли пароль»
Strapi предлагает встроенную функцию «Забыли пароль», которая позволяет легко сбросить пароль. Чтобы использовать этот метод, выполните следующие действия:
- Перейдите на страницу входа в Strapi.
- Нажмите ссылку «Забыли пароль».
- Введите свой адрес электронной почты, связанный с вашей учетной записью Strapi.
- Проверьте свою электронную почту на наличие ссылки для сброса пароля.
- Нажмите на ссылку и следуйте инструкциям, чтобы создать новый пароль.
Метод 2: сброс пароля через базу данных Strapi
Если функция «Забыли пароль» недоступна или по какой-либо причине не работает, вы можете вручную сбросить пароль, обратившись к базе данных Strapi. Вот как:
- Доступ к базе данных Strapi с помощью инструмента управления базами данных (например, phpMyAdmin для MySQL).
- Найдите таблицу «users-permissions_user».
- Найдите пользователя, для которого вы хотите сбросить пароль.
- Обновите поле «пароль», указав новый зашифрованный пароль. Вы можете использовать онлайн-генераторы паролей или инструменты шифрования для создания безопасного хеша.
- Сохраните изменения и выйдите из инструмента управления базой данных.
- Войдите в Strapi, используя обновленный пароль.
Метод 3: изменение пользователя-администратора через интерфейс командной строки (CLI)
Strapi предоставляет интерфейс командной строки (CLI), который позволяет вам взаимодействовать с вашим проектом. Вы можете использовать CLI для изменения пользователя-администратора и сброса пароля. Выполните следующие действия:
- Откройте терминал или командную строку и перейдите в каталог проекта Strapi.
- Выполните следующую команду для доступа к интерфейсу командной строки Strapi:
npx strapi - Открыв интерфейс командной строки, введите
strapi admin:update-userи нажмите Enter. - Вам будет предложено ввести имя пользователя и пароль администратора.
- Введите новый пароль при появлении запроса и подтвердите изменения.
- Перезагрузите сервер Strapi, и вы сможете войти в систему с обновленным паролем.
Метод 4: восстановление из резервной копии
Если все остальное не помогло и у вас есть недавняя резервная копия вашей установки Strapi, вы можете восстановить ее до точки, в которой вы помните пароль. Вот что вам нужно сделать:
- Найдите резервную копию вашего проекта Strapi, желательно резервную копию, сделанную до того, как вы забыли пароль.
- Восстановите резервную копию на своем сервере или в локальной среде.
- Войдите в Strapi, используя запомненный пароль из резервной копии.
- После входа в систему вы можете обновить пароль на новый через панель управления Strapi.
Потеря доступа к вашей учетной записи Strapi может быть неприятной, но с помощью методов, описанных в этой статье, у вас есть несколько вариантов восстановить свой пароль и восстановить контроль над вашей системой управления контентом. Не забывайте всегда хранить свои пароли в безопасности и рассмотрите возможность внедрения механизмов восстановления паролей, чтобы избежать подобных ситуаций в будущем. Удачного стрейпинга!